ABSTRACT

In article described research the results of the prevalence of the genetic polymorphism of the gene Methylentetrahydrofolatereductase C677T (MTHFR) in 130 patients with pseudarthrosis of long bones and in those with consolidated fractures. The incidence of allele-T among patients with pseudarthrosis was 1.4 times higher than among those with consolidated fractures. Pathological genotype MTHFR 677-TT was associated with the development avital types of pseudarthrosis and increase the proportion of people with hyperhomocysteinemia, high content of inflammatory mediators and development refracture.

ABSTRACT

In article described research of frequency of endothelial dysfunction in 153 patients with pseudarthrosis of long bones and in individuals with consolidated fractures. The reparative regeneration are associated by structural and functional disorders of the central and peripheral vessels as endothelial dysfunction, thickening of the intima-media, prevails at hypoplastic and atrophic types bone nonunion, neurotrofic syndrome and refractures. Endothelial function was significantly dependent on the levels of homocysteine, total cholesterol and interleukin-6 in serum.

ABSTRACT

In article described research of the metabolic status and bone mineral density in 153 patients with with pseudarthrosis of long bones, in individuals with consolidated fractures and healthy people. The violations of reparative osteogenesis at hyperhomocysteinemia are accompanied by disturbances of the functional state of bone tissue, inhibition of biosynthetic and increased destruction processes, reduced bone mineral density in the formation of osteopenia and osteoporosis. The degree and direction of change of bone depends on the type of violation of reparative osteogenesis.

ABSTRACT

The author presents in the article the results of treatment patients with fibula stump syndrome. Some aspects of pathogenesis of development of this form of amputation pain after amputation were clarified by the author in the article as well as clinical and morphological disease criteria. Differential assessment of efficiency of conservative treatment and surgery depending on the severity of pain syndrome has been carried out.
